This paper provides a synopsis of the current regulatory and institutional arrangements that pertain to the urban water and wastewater sector in Australia. A short and selected institutional history of the urban water sectors in the Australian cities of Sydney and Melbourne is outlined, followed by an analysis of the relative effectiveness of the institutional structures in enabling the sector to respond to the challenges faced by the sector in the future.
► Provides an overview of the regulatory and institutional structure that governs the Australian water sector.
► Outlines some elements from the history of urban water institutions that explain current issues for sector.
► Explores the extent to which the current arrangements position the sector for sustainable growth.
